What problems do 2015 Jeep Wranglers have?

The 2015 Jeep Wrangler also is reported to have TIPM issues. Problems like erratic or complete failure systems like wiper, horn, cabin electronics, and fuel pump are precursors to issues with the module.

How good is the 3.6 Jeep motor?

The 3.6 L FCA Pentastar V6 Engine is an overwhelmingly durable and reliable engine. That’s why it’s been used in in more than ten million Chrysler, Dodge, and Jeep vehicles since 2010. With proper maintenance the 3.6L Pentastar engine can provide years of reliable service.

What are the problems with the 3.6 Pentastar engine?

Fiat Chrysler’s Pentastar 3.6L V6 engines allegedly experience contamination of the engine oil, according to a class action lawsuit that claims defects lead to engine failure. The Pentastar V6 problems include hesitation, misfires, surges, ticking, bucking, loss of power and, ultimately, engine failure.

Do Jeep Wranglers rust easily?

The Jeep Wranglers and Jeep Gladiators suffer from corrosion, resulting in rust development on the doors panels and door hinges. Additionally, the corrosion causes the Jeep Wrangler’s paint to peel, flake, bubble or blister.

What year Jeeps are being recalled?

Chrysler Recalls 2020-2022 Jeep Wrangler, 2021-2022 Jeep Gladiator, and 2020-2022 Ram 1500. Chrysler (FCA US, LLC) is recalling certain 2020-2022 Jeep Wrangler, Ram 1500, and 2021-2022 Jeep Gladiator vehicles equipped with 3.0L diesel engines. The high pressure fuel pump (HPFP) may fail, causing an engine stall.

What year Jeep should I avoid?

When looking at the worst-performing models of the Jeep Wrangler, 2012 took the win. Among the issues it had, there have been 9 recalls, making it the worst for Jeep. The 2007 and 2008 Jeep Wranglers are not too far from that, as they have 10 and 9 recalls, respectively.
